Sure! So since i’m a designer most other designers have a personal website with their contact info. Many list their email on linkedin as well. If they have neither, i look at what company they’re at currently and use this site mailscoop.io which helps you find a person’s email if you know their company. Have been able to reach people successfully this way. Good luck!
